Both these things were fabulous. The pizza did have too much going on for me though, and the ricotta didn’t add to do like I thought it would. If I were to go again I’d definitely go back to a margarita. The ravioli was great, can’t complain. The drinks menu was also really extensive and the staff were friendly. But for the amount of money I paid I would’ve expected to come out much happier and fuller. I think that there is Italian that is just as good if not better for much cheaper. And there are better places for the same price range. But in saying that I would go back if someone invited me, it’s obviously good food. 3/5 🌟
